Understanding Gradations

Ayurvedic medicines encompass a spectrum, ranging from simple herbal remedies to more complex formulations. It is crucial to recognise that not all Ayurvedic products are the same. Simple herbs, sourced from reliable providers, are generally free from heavy metals. However, certain potent formulations may include ingredients where the presence of heavy metals is a possibility.


The Vital Role of Ayurvedic Doctors

One aspect often overlooked is the significant role played by Ayurvedic doctors. Unlike over-the-counter medications, specific Ayurvedic formulations are meant to be prescribed by qualified practitioners. Ayurvedic doctors undergo extensive training to comprehend the intricacies of herbal combinations, ensuring the safety and efficacy of the prescribed remedies.


The Significance of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P)

To address concerns about heavy metals in Ayurvedic supplements, it is crucial to highlight the importance of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P). Reputable Ayurvedic manufacturers adhere to strict GMP standards, employing processes that minimise the risk of contamination. As consumers, it is imperative to choose products from trusted brands prioritising quality control and transparency in their production methods.
